After digging through the forums, I tried to copy the usbstor.inf and .pnf to the Windows\inf directory and reinstalled the driver through the Device Manager, and it loaded right up.
I don't know, but I suspect that the impact of this change, there are other devices that can complain. For now, the process of transfer between W7 and VMWARE/linux seems flawless.

Troubleshooting you can try:
Note the use of Win Key + X and Win Key + W (to go on the Control Panel, Run and parameters
According to needs). Win + D key calls the office and using Win Key active / disable the Office
and the splash screen.Follow these steps to remove corruption and missing/damaged file system repair or replacement.
Windows key + X (or right click in the lower left corner) - (Admin) command prompt
C:\Windows\System32\ >
At the prompt, type in SFC/scannow above
(There is a space between C and /)How to run the command "SFC/scannow" at startup or in Windows 8
http://www.eightforums.com/tutorials/3047-sfc-scannow-command-run-Windows-8-a.html-----
Then run CheckDisk (chkfdsk/f/r)
File (formerly Windows Explorer)
Right click on drive C: - Properties - tab tools - error checking - Check
Windows 8/8.1 - improve performance by optimizing your hard drive - see "to repair a drive:
http://Windows.Microsoft.com/en-us/Windows-8/improve-performance-optimizing-hard-driveHow to check a drive for errors with "chkdsk" in Windows 8/8.1
http://www.eightforums.com/tutorials/6221-chkdsk-check-drive-errors-Windows-8-a.html-----------------------------------------------
Then lets refresh the USB stack
Control the click Control Panel - Device Manager - no matter where in the box of white/white - then the VIEW - see the
Devices disabled - look around (with the exception of USB controllers) for your devices (can have
zero or more than one) and top - right click UNINSTALL.Control Panel right CLICK on EVERYTHING - Serial USB controllers - device configuration-manager and
UNINSTALL all but the category itself - REBOOT - it refreshes the driver and battery USBThis KB shows XP how to and methods of Vista and Windows 7 are identical (and
Windows 8/8.1)
http://support.Microsoft.com/kb/310575This is a utility to help you, but do 1 above.
USBDeview is a small utility that lists all USB devices currently connected to your computer.
as well as all USB devices that you previously used. Run Options and tick three 1
are there choices to see if any.http://www.NirSoft.NET/utils/usb_devices_view.html
You must remove all instances of the devices and restart.
